  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/UI2/CDMFCC052 - Resource type &1 with id &2 not deleted ?
    The SAP error message /UI2/CDMFCC052 Resource type &1 with id &2 not deleted typically indicates that there was an attempt to delete a resource (such as a catalog, group, or tile) in the SAP Fiori Launchpad or related UI technologies, but the deletion was unsuccessful. The placeholders &1 and &2 represent the resource type and the resource ID, respectively.
    
    Cause: Resource Not Found: The resource you are trying to delete may not exist or may have already been deleted.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to delete the specified resource. Dependencies: The resource may be in use or have dependencies that prevent it from being deleted. System Issues: There may be underlying system issues or inconsistencies in the database that are preventing the deletion.
